플그래밍/파이써언

[파이썬] 입력값의 팩토리얼 계산하기

훗티v 2022. 1. 20. 06:59

 

문제 - 파이썬 팩토리얼

- 입력된 숫자의 팩토리얼을 계산해보자.

 

 

코드 - 파이썬 팩토리얼

def fact(x):
    if x == 0:
        return 1
    return x * fact(x - 1) # 결과 반환

x = int(input()) # 입력값 받기
print(f'팩토리얼 {x} : {fact(x)}') # 결과 추출
print(f'------------------')
print(f'팩토리얼 2 : {1*2}')
print(f'팩토리얼 3 : {1*2*3}')
print(f'팩토리얼 4 : {1*2*3*4}')
print(f'팩토리얼 5 : {1*2*3*4*5}')

 

결과 - 파이썬 팩토리얼

 

 

 

 

 

[플그래밍/파이써언] - [파이썬] 7로 나누어 떨어지고 5의 배수가 아닌 숫자 찾기

[플그래밍/파이써언] - [파이썬] 폴더 내 파일 확장자별로 분류하기

[플그래밍/파이써언] - [파이썬] 공공데이터 API - 지역별 아파트 매매 내역 추출하기

[플그래밍/파이써언] - [파이썬] 판다스 CSV > XLSX 엑셀 변환

[플그래밍/파이써언] - [파이썬] 판다스 엑셀 파일 만들기

 

 

 

 

 

 

728x90